The way Progressive Jackpots Truly Work

When you understand the workings, the excitement intensifies because the mystery evaporates and you know exactly what you’re putting money into. Each progressive jackpot at Mostbet Casino starts with a seed amount provided by the casino, which ensures that even immediately following a win, the pot resets to a decent figure. From that moment, a tiny portion of any qualifying bet, often around one to three per cent, gets diverted into the jackpot pool. In a network progressive, that contribution originates from thousands of players across multiple casinos, which explains why those totals can jump by hundreds of pounds in minutes during peak UK evening hours. I always review the game rules because some progressives require a maximum bet or a specific side bet to claim the top prize, while others give the jackpot randomly on any spin regardless of stake size. The latter is my guilty pleasure; knowing the mega payout can land even on a modest twenty‑pence spin maintains me relaxed and appreciating the ride rather than fretting about my bankroll. Understanding RTP, Volatility, and Jackpot Triggers

I tackle progressive play with a somewhat different mathematical lens than I use for regular slots, and I think UK players gain a lot from grasping these nuances early. Most progressive slots carry a slightly lower base‑game RTP compared to non‑progressives, because a portion of the return is funneled into the communal jackpot. That doesn’t trouble me at all once I acknowledge that I’m trading a sliver of steady theoretical return for a chance at a life‑altering sum. Volatility becomes an even greater conversation piece. Many jackpot slots sit in the high‑volatility bracket, indicating I might endure long stretches of smaller or no wins before the bonus feature kicks in. I’ve discovered to bankroll carefully and enjoy those quiet stretches as dramatic build‑up rather than frustration. The actual trigger mechanism varies wildly. Some games require a full screen of wild symbols, others spin a bonus wheel, and a handful, like the random jackpots, can come out of nowhere.
